Control of Hazardous Energy LOTO Approximately 3 million workers service equipment and face the greatest risk of injury if LO/ TO is not properly implemented. Compliance with the LO/ TO standard prevents an estimated 120 fatalities and 50, 000 injuries each year.  more...

The ATEX Directives For staff to have an understanding of hazardous area terminology and techniques and the implications of the ATEX Directives. ATEX is a European directive and has no real place in the USA unless staff would like to understand the markings on equipment that you sometimes see in the US. ATEX has been accepted as a RP (Recommended Practice) in the Middle East and other areas of The World. a  more...
